The restaurant looks clean, modern, and inviting, and the overall presentation gives the impression of an authentic South Asian dining experience. Unfortunately, the food, especially the naan, did not live up to that expectation or the prices.

The naan was thin, flat, and rubbery, with a chewy texture that made it hard to digest. This usually happens when naan is not properly fermented, rolled too thin, or cooked on a low-heat surface instead of a traditional high-heat tandoor. Authentic naan should be soft, fluffy, slightly charred, and airy, with visible bubbles and a tender bite, none of which were present here.

Given the higher prices, serving naan that feels pre-made or pan-cooked is disappointing. Bread is a core part of the cuisine, and when it is done incorrectly, it impacts the entire meal.

While the restaurant itself looks great, the execution of basic items needs improvement. I would only consider returning if the naan quality and authenticity are addressed.
